GROUNDING AND AC POWER CORD CONNECTIONS

This battery charger is for use on a nominal 120 volt circuit and has a grounded plug. The charger must
8.1
be grounded, to reduce the risk of electric shock. The plug must be plugged into an outlet that is properly
installed and grounded in accordance with all local codes and ordinances. The plug pins must fit the
receptacle (outlet). Do not use with an ungrounded system.
DANGER: Never alter the AC cord or plug provided – if it does not fit the outlet, have a proper grounded
8.2
outlet installed by a qualified electrician. An improper connection can result in a risk of an electric shock
or electrocution.
NOTE: Pursuant to Canadian Regulations, use of an adapter plug is not allowed in Canada. Use of an
adapter plug in the United States is not recommended and should not be used.

10. CONTROL PANEL

LED INDICATORS
CLAMPS REVERSED (red) LED flashing: The connections are reversed.
CHARGING (yellow/orange) LED lit: The charger is charging the battery.
CHARGING (yellow/orange) LED flashing: The charger is in abort mode.
CHARGED/MAINTAINING (green) LED lit: The battery is fully charged and the charger is in maintain mode.
NOTE: See Operating Instructions for a complete description of the charger modes.
RATE SELECTION
The charge rate is measured in amps. The charger will automatically adjust the charging current, based
on battery size, in order to charge the battery completely, efficiently and safely. Do not use for industrial
applications.

11. OPERATING INSTRUCTIONS

WARNING: A SPARK NEAR THE BATTERY MAY CAUSE AN EXPLOSION.
IMPORTANT: Do not start the vehicle with the charger connected to the AC outlet, or it could result in
damage to the charger.
NOTE: This charger is equipped with an auto-start feature. Current will not be supplied to the battery
clamps until a battery is properly connected. The clamps will not spark if touched together.
